Help! “Prepped for” Furrion and Tire Linc????
Hello, I am looking for info on the pre-wired options on a 2024 Micro Minnie 2108FBS. Have searched and just need to know the scoop on the Furrion back up camera and the Tire Linc tpms systems.
Are they really plug and play?
The stealership wants huge money for small stuff.
Dual lithium batteries $2k
2000w inverter install $4k
Install their Blu Ox they sell for $130
Is the rear mount for the camera actually wired back to the power?
The side camera mounts must be wired as they use power from the side marker lights
Is the puck for the Tire Linc actually powered?
Hoping all I would need to do is attach the puck to the bracket and add tire stem sensors.
Should the tire stems be metal to handle the sensor weight?
I assume the wheels do not have the standard tpms that are on tow vehicle tires lately.
They say the inverter prep is not really prepped at all and they have to run all wiring, trying to charge $50 for each outlet, etc. schematics I see show they are all on the same circuit.
Any and all help appreciated! My search here has shown some info on this but not the specific answers I need.

Woah there… the Spring Hill battery plant is making a totally different chemistry and type of battery than the type used in current LiFePO4 batteries being used in RVs. So, at this point there is no one other than China making cells/pouches used in RV LFP batteries.
The GM Ultium plant is making cells for (mostly) GM EV Car batteries, reportedly using Lithium Ion chemistry. These are not the Lithium Iron Phosphate prismatic cells used in our batteries.

I bought the tire linc system and it comes with everything needed whether you are prepped or not. (The pre-installed bracket that is included on your trailer was also included in the kit.) It is really as easy as you suspect. You just drop the controller (puck) in the pre-installed mount bracket, install the valve stem caps, and pair them. (you need the phone app). It was pretty simple.

Help prepped for Furrion
The micromini and mini are wired for the rear camera. However the wire is hot at all times so your camera will always be on. Furron rear camera units typically are switched by connecting to the rear running lights. With little effort you can reach the adjacent running light wiring and pull the wires through the opening and attach to your camera. I also found the camera bracket Winnebago provides needs to be replaced with the Furron mounting plate. Be sure to use some sealant along the top of your new bracket to prevent moisture from entering your trailer.
